Mainstream magnesium export prices have been stable at USD 3,360~3,410/t FOB China with taxes or USD 3,330~3,380/t FOB China without taxes, holding stable from early this week. In view of weak demand on the global market and stagnating domestic magnesium prices, industry commentators forecast magnesium export prices to remain stable at the current level next week.

A northern magnesium exporter reported domestic magnesium prices at RMB 21,400/t (USD 3,170/t) ex-works without taxes by cash with tightening supply, so export prices have been quoted at USD 3,300/t FOB China without tax. According to an internal source, “We sold 20 t of magnesium at USD 3,330/t FOB China last week, and concluded a 100 t deal at USD 3,290/t FOB China for shipment in March 2023. We expect prices to keep stable at the current level next week given steady domestic prices”.
